广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> APP开发 > 系统开发:方法论与实践之道

陈经理

15年全栈工程师

广州红匣子技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

系统开发:方法论与实践之道

时间:2025-06-08 03:39:00来源:红匣子科技阅读:250608
在当今快速发展的科技领域,系统开发已成为企业核心竞争力的关键所在。无论是软件产品还是数字服务,其背后都需要专业的开发团队和科学的方法论支持。本文将深入探讨系统开发的全过程,从方法论到实践,为读者提供全面的指导,助您在开发过程中事半功倍。part1:系统开发的整体思路系统开发是一项复杂而系统的过程,需

在当今快速发展的科技领域,系统开发已成为企业核心竞争力的关键所在。无论是软件产品还是数字服务,其背后都需要专业的开发团队和科学的方法论支持。本文将深入探讨系统开发的全过程,从方法论到实践,为读者提供全面的指导,助您在开发过程中事半功倍。

part1:系统开发的整体思路

系统开发是一项复杂而系统的过程,需要从整体上把握项目的脉络。开发团队需要明确项目的终极目标,这不仅是技术实现,更是业务价值的体现。例如,一个电子商务系统的开发,不仅要考虑商品展示和订单处理功能,更要关注用户体验的提升,比如页面加载速度和用户操作流畅度。

开发过程中的每一个阶段都需要清晰的分工。从需求分析到设计实现,再到测试和优化,每一个环节都不可或缺。这种分阶段、分模块的开发方式,不仅能够提高效率,还能确保每个部分都得到充分的验证和优化。

“开发即运营”是一个越来越被认可的理念。开发不仅仅是编写代码,更是为系统的持续运行提供支持。这意味着开发团队需要将用户反馈纳入开发流程,通过迭代优化来提升系统的稳定性和可用性。

敏捷开发和持续集成的方法论为现代系统开发提供了强大的工具支持。通过短周期的迭代和快速的反馈机制,开发团队可以及时发现问题并进行调整,确保项目朝着既定的目标稳步前进。

part2:系统开发的具体方法论

在系统开发中,架构设计是核心环节。一个良好的架构设计不仅能够提高系统的可维护性,还能降低维护成本。例如,通过模块化设计,团队可以将不同的功能分离,方便后续扩展和维护。选择合适的数据库、前后端框架和工具,也能显著提升开发效率。

需求分析是系统开发的基础,团队需要深入理解业务需求,确保技术实现能够满足实际需求。在需求分析阶段,可以通过用户访谈、数据分析和原型设计等方式,全面了解用户需求。这样,开发过程中才能避免偏差,确保最终产品能够满足用户期待。

测试阶段是系统开发中至关重要的一环。通过单元测试、集成测试和性能测试,可以有效保障系统的稳定性和可靠性。特别是在复杂的系统中,测试可以帮助发现潜在的问题,确保每个模块都能正常运行。

系统的优化是一个持续的过程。通过性能监控、日志分析和用户反馈,开发团队可以不断优化系统的运行效率和用户体验。例如,通过A/B测试,可以快速确定哪种功能设计更符合用户需求。

系统开发是一项需要系统性思维和持续改进的复杂过程。通过明确目标、合理分工、科学方法,开发团队可以事半功的完成项目,并为系统的长期发展奠定坚实的基础。无论是企业还是要么个人,掌握系统开发的方法论,都是提升能力的重要途径。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:系统开发:数字时代的基石

下一篇:系统程序开发:构建数字未来的基石

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询